eclipse - Class files are not generated in pom.xml -


i using below pom.xml application

<project xmlns="http://maven.apache.org/pom/4.0.0" xmlns:xsi="http://www.w3.org/2001/xmlschema-instance" xsi:schemalocation="http://maven.apache.org/pom/4.0.0 http://maven.apache.org/maven-v4_0_0.xsd"> <modelversion>4.0.0</modelversion> <groupid>${project.name}</groupid> <artifactid>${project.name}</artifactid> <packaging>war</packaging> <version>1.0-snapshot</version> <name>service_request</name>  <repositories>     <repository>         <id>prime-repo</id>         <name>prime repo</name>         <url>http://repository.primefaces.org</url>     </repository> </repositories>  <dependencies>      <!-- primefaces -->     <dependency>         <groupid>org.primefaces</groupid>         <artifactid>primefaces</artifactid>         <version>3.5</version>     </dependency>     <dependency>         <groupid>org.primefaces.extensions</groupid>         <artifactid>all-themes</artifactid>         <version>1.0.8</version>     </dependency>      <!-- jsf -->     <dependency>         <groupid>com.sun.faces</groupid>         <artifactid>jsf-api</artifactid>         <version>2.1.21</version>     </dependency>     <dependency>         <groupid>com.sun.faces</groupid>         <artifactid>jsf-impl</artifactid>         <version>2.1.21</version>     </dependency>      <dependency>         <groupid>javax.servlet</groupid>         <artifactid>jstl</artifactid>         <version>1.2</version>     </dependency>      <dependency>         <groupid>javax.servlet</groupid>         <artifactid>servlet-api</artifactid>         <version>2.5</version>     </dependency>      <dependency>         <groupid>javax.servlet.jsp</groupid>         <artifactid>jsp-api</artifactid>         <version>2.1</version>     </dependency>      <dependency>         <groupid>org.glassfish</groupid>         <artifactid>javax.faces</artifactid>         <version>2.1.21</version>     </dependency>      <dependency>         <groupid>com.sun.jersey</groupid>         <artifactid>jersey-client</artifactid>         <version>1.16</version>     </dependency>      <dependency>         <groupid>com.sun.jersey</groupid>         <artifactid>jersey-core</artifactid>         <version>1.16</version>     </dependency>      <dependency>         <groupid>com.oracle</groupid>         <artifactid>ojdbc14</artifactid>         <version>10.2.0.3.0</version>         <type>pom</type>     </dependency>       <!-- el -->     <dependency>         <groupid>org.glassfish.web</groupid>         <artifactid>el-impl</artifactid>         <version>2.2</version>     </dependency>     <dependency>         <groupid>com.sun.el</groupid>         <artifactid>el-ri</artifactid>         <version>1.0</version>     </dependency> </dependencies> <build>     <finalname>${project.name}</finalname>     <resources>         <resource>             <directory>${project.basedir}/src/main/resources</directory>         </resource>     </resources>     <plugins>         <plugin>             <groupid>org.apache.maven.plugins</groupid>             <artifactid>maven-war-plugin</artifactid>             <configuration>                 <warsourcedirectory>webcontent</warsourcedirectory>                 <warsourceexcludes>webcontent/web-inf/lib/*.jar</warsourceexcludes>                 <archiveclasses>false</archiveclasses>             </configuration>         </plugin>     </plugins> </build> 

but unable generate class files inside target directory. except class files got everything. project structure is, projectname>src>com>...source files. following same structure other application , getting class files in that. dont know missing. both pom.xml similar

your java source files need go src/main/java maven convention (not src)


Comments

Popular posts from this blog

linux - xterm copying to CLIPBOARD using copy-selection causes automatic updating of CLIPBOARD upon mouse selection -

c++ - qgraphicsview horizontal scrolling always has a vertical delta -